Description
Park Wieniawskiego (Wieniawskiego Park) is one of the oldest parks in Poznań. Delimited by Fredry Street, Wieniawskiego Street and Noskowskiego Street, in summer it is a regular meeting place for the residents of Poznań.
How to get there:
From the railway station (Poznań Główny), "Dworzec Zachodni" exit
- Tram no. 8 or 14 from "Dworzec Zachodni" stop to "Most Teatralny" stop; continue on foot across Teatralny Bridge
From the railway station (Poznań Główny), main exit or "Dworzec Zachodni" exit
- Tram no. 10, 11 or 12 from "Most Dworcowy" stop to "Most Teatralny" stop; continue on foot across Teatralny Bridge
From the Old Market Square (Stary Rynek)
- On foot up Paderewskiego Street, across Plac Wolności, up 27 Grudnia Street and Fredry Street
- On foot up Paderewskiego Street; tram no. 3, 9, 13 or 16 from "Marcinkowskiego" stop to "Fredry" stop; continue on foot up Fredry Street; or one of the above trams to "Most Teatralny" stop; continue on foot across Teatralny Bridge
